Possible Causes of Toilet Overflow in Montclair
One common cause of toilet overflows is a clog in the drain or vent stack blocking proper water flow. When waste and toilet paper build up beyond the plumbing’s capacity, the water can back up and spill out onto your bathroom floor, creating water damage and potential mold issues if not addressed promptly.
Another frequent culprit is a malfunctioning flapper or float arm inside the toilet tank. If these parts stop working correctly, water can continue to fill the bowl or tank beyond safe levels, resulting in overflow. Sewer line blockages or tree root intrusion can also contribute to sewage backups, making the overflow more severe and contaminated.

What should I do immediately after a toilet overflows?
Turn off the water supply to prevent further flooding. Carefully remove standing water if possible and ventilate the area. Call our team at (888) 884-7150 for emergency cleanup and restoration services.
Will my insurance cover toilet overflow damage?
Coverage varies depending on your policy. Typically, damages caused by sudden and accidental overflows are covered, but it’s best to check with your provider. We can assist you in documenting the damage for your claim.
